| CVE-2019-16777 | 5 Fedoraproject, Npmjs, Opensuse and 2 more | 8 Fedora, Npm, Leap and 5 more | 2024-11-21 | 7.7 High |
| Versions of the npm CLI prior to 6.13.4 are vulnerable to an Arbitrary File Overwrite. It fails to prevent existing globally-installed binaries to be overwritten by other package installations. For example, if a package was installed globally and created a serve binary, any subsequent installs of packages that also create a serve binary would overwrite the previous serve binary. This behavior is still allowed in local installations and also through install scripts. This vulnerability bypasses a user using the --ignore-scripts install option. | ||||
| CVE-2019-16776 | 5 Fedoraproject, Npmjs, Opensuse and 2 more | 8 Fedora, Npm, Leap and 5 more | 2024-11-21 | 7.7 High |
| Versions of the npm CLI prior to 6.13.3 are vulnerable to an Arbitrary File Write. It fails to prevent access to folders outside of the intended node_modules folder through the bin field. A properly constructed entry in the package.json bin field would allow a package publisher to modify and/or gain access to arbitrary files on a user's system when the package is installed. This behavior is still possible through install scripts. This vulnerability bypasses a user using the --ignore-scripts install option. | ||||
| CVE-2019-16765 | 1 Microsoft | 1 Codeql | 2024-11-21 | 7.4 High |
| If an attacker can get a user to open a specially prepared directory tree as a workspace in Visual Studio Code with the CodeQL extension active, arbitrary code of the attacker's choosing may be executed on the user's behalf. This is fixed in version 1.0.1 of the extension. Users should upgrade to this version using Visual Studio Code Marketplace's upgrade mechanism. After upgrading, the codeQL.cli.executablePath setting can only be set in the per-user settings, and not in the per-workspace settings. | CVE-2019-16511 | 1 Firegiant | 1 Wix Toolset | 2024-11-21 | 5.5 Medium |
| An issue was discovered in DTF in FireGiant WiX Toolset before 3.11.2. Microsoft.Deployment.Compression.Cab.dll and Microsoft.Deployment.Compression.Zip.dll allow directory traversal during CAB or ZIP archive extraction, because the full name of an archive file (even with a ../ sequence) is concatenated with the destination path. | ||||

| CVE-2019-16064 | 1 Netsas | 1 Enigma Network Management Solution | 2024-11-21 | 9.6 Critical |
| NETSAS Enigma NMS 65.0.0 and prior suffers from a directory traversal vulnerability that can allow an authenticated user to access files and directories stored outside of the web root folder. By exploiting this vulnerability, it is possible for an attacker to list operating-system directory contents on the server, create directories and upload files in permissible locations, and modify filenames and delete files that are accessible by the user running the web server instance. | ||||
